Norske Luftruter was an airline that flew the route from Lübeck-Priwall Airport ( Lübeck / Travemünde ) to Oslo in the 1920s and 1930s .
The route was originally operated by Luft Hansa AG , but Norske Luftruter was founded specifically for this connection . She used the flying boats Rohrbach Ro V "Rocco" , Dornier Wal and Dornier Do R ("Superwal").
